Output ea38ffcec3b797a75bd006815b96796486f8a1b5ef671e3bb69c5b2763c318c4:17

value
66219343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b63905e12c7db7106ca6916595d87ba694d0809d OP_EQUAL
address
3JJXDUv4BpepzDRazxdCtZ3UBDWjdKuNFG
transaction
ea38ffcec3b797a75bd006815b96796486f8a1b5ef671e3bb69c5b2763c318c4
spent
true